Arthur Spencer Carl Lloyd (Carl) Anderson was born in 1894 in Rice Lake, Wisconsin, USA, the child of Karel Charles Carl Halvor Anderson And Nikoline Elise Tonnessen. In 1910, Arthur Spencer Carl Lloyd (Carl) Anderson resided in Milwaukee Ward 5, Milwaukee, Wisconsin. In 1920, Arthur Spencer Carl Lloyd (Carl) Anderson resided in Owen, Clark, Wisconsin. Arthur Spencer Carl Lloyd (Carl) Anderson married Anna Emma Ella Klabunde, and had children including Harry Lawrence Arthur Anderson. Arthur Spencer Carl Lloyd (Carl) Anderson passed away in 1967 in Rochester, Olmsted, Minnesota, USA.
